    Title = Monkeys On Tour

    Arms draped around necks like monkeys
    Signifies insufferable co-dependencies
    Boredom of existing and tired of life
    Just clinging to their sub-mate, sub-mistress, sub-wife
    Trudging through life and barely clinging to affection
    And in the air, I see brewing a quick disaffection
    Of would be spouses from would be spousettes
    Attempting great escapes from houses, mortgages and pets
    But who am I to scorn their world?
    When I’ve been caught up by a handful of girls
    And I’ve been head over feet for a fair few myself
    A feeling which on occasion I just couldn’t help
    Where I’d compromise my very identity
    Just so that my subjects would attend to me
    But unhealthy affections or true love divine
    I’m proud of my weaknesses purely because they are mine
    My story is complex, twisted and at times convoluted
    Because me and my monster are just perfectly suited
    And at present the M word is swearing to me
    But alas one day married I may well just be
    But for now I’m enjoying the bachelor’s life
    With maximum enjoyment and minimal strife
    Party ’til you’ve passed out, sleep when you’re dead
    But sleeping is a boring thing to do in my bed
    Buy me a drink and come over here
    Make it a vodka, I’m not a boy for beer
    I’ll entertain and amaze, maybe hazard a gaze
    Then I’ll tell you a secret whilst I nibble your ear…
    ANTHONY ARNOLD 2009
